Reconciliation Specialist II

Vantage BankMcAllen, TX

About The Position

The Reconciliation Specialist II is responsible for reconciling general ledger and internal DDA accounts, monitoring account variances, and notifying the appropriate parties to resolve outstanding items. They ensure reconciliations are completed accurately and within established timelines and provide backup support for department as needed.
